> I don't know if this is an issue, but we don't use an absolute path to
> the solution file.
> So instead of
> <solutionfile>D:\Inetpub\health.lefebvre.us\PA.DOH.BHS.Surveys.sln</solu
> tionfile>
> we would use:
> <solutionfile> PA.DOH.BHS.Surveys.sln</solutionfile>
> The reason is, that draco checks out the files to a temporary location.
> If you specify an absolute path, draco doesn't the file from sourcesafe,
> but your existing copy of the file.
